Output 342c5c3ba110d13c46c31f8e4a2b310cdd413b2fa6ccaeeb7aa7a0f584c77464:14

value
882478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5051d1b303e12653ded6ce3bc6ea517a816187d9 OP_EQUAL
address
391hznQ6fwYfV19prrnu12aK6cCkLbAne9
transaction
342c5c3ba110d13c46c31f8e4a2b310cdd413b2fa6ccaeeb7aa7a0f584c77464
spent
true